Kennedy Silver Half Dollars in Whitman Coin Binders, 1964–1968. This lot of twelve includes four 90% silver Kennedy half dollars from 1964 and eight 40% silver clad Kennedy half dollars from 1965–1968. These coins feature a left-facing John F. Kennedy to the obverse and the National Seal to the reverse. Designer: Gilroy Roberts/Frank Gasparro. Metal Content: 90% silver, 10% copper (1964 only). Diameter: 30.6 mm. Weight: approx. 12.5 grams (1964 only). Coins appear lightly circulated to uncirculated.
